Harvest Moon Ball – Friday, September 12, 2025 | MGM Grand Detroit
We are delighted to invite you to join us in celebrating the 16th annual Harvest Moon Ball. Harvest Moon Ball is Henry Ford Wyandotte Hospital’s fundraising gala that features wonderful cuisine, dancing, live entertainment, the renowned diamond raffle, silent auction, and regular raffle. Your support of the 2025 Harvest Moon Ball will help fund the new, state-of-the-art cancer infusion center in Wyandotte. The new location, steps away from Henry Ford Wyandotte Hospital, will provide a higher level of patient-centric care, and increased privacy for those undergoing cancer-related infusion and treatments.
